Transaction fd29112599ca1755a87688b964d483987983f9138c5da4e1a98b4352258f4ccb

2 Input
2 Outputs
  • fd29112599ca1755a87688b964d483987983f9138c5da4e1a98b4352258f4ccb:0
  • value  70000000
    address  165e4s8STkRckEGXGunGEszKFmiuePCZaC
  • fd29112599ca1755a87688b964d483987983f9138c5da4e1a98b4352258f4ccb:1
  • value  747056
    address  3MYkXZx12JZaUnEgUDeXdZYKzPCsxkELvy